Shutemov" Just like MKTME, TDX reassigns bits of the physical address for metadata. MKTME used several bits for an encryption KeyID. TDX uses a single bit in guests to communicate whether a physical page should be protected by TDX as private memory (bit set to 0) or unprotected and shared with the VMM (bit set to 1). __set_memory_enc_dec() is now aware about TDX and sets Shared bit accordingly following with relevant TDX hypercall. Also, Do TDACCEPTPAGE on every 4k page after mapping the GPA range when converting memory to private. Using 4k page size limit is due to current TDX spec restriction. Also, If the GPA (range) was already mapped as an active, private page, the host VMM may remove the private page from the TD by following the “Removing TD Private Pages” sequence in the Intel TDX-module specification [1] to safely block the mapping(s), flush the TLB and cache, and remove the mapping(s). BUG() if TDACCEPTPAGE fails (except "previously accepted page" case) , as the guest is completely hosed if it can't access memory.  [1] https://software.intel.com/content/dam/develop/external/us/en/documents/tdx-module-1eas-v0.85.039.pdf Tested-by: Kai Huang Signed-off-by: Kirill A.
